'EastEnders' axe baby abduction plot

EastEnders producers today made the decision to pull their baby abduction storyline.

The news comes only weeks after Coronation Street bosses axed their missing child storyline in view of recent events in Portugal.

The Walford plot would have seen Dr May (Amanda Drew) run off with Dawn (Kara Tointon) and Rob's (Stuart Laing) baby shortly after it had been born.

Of the decision, a spokeswoman for the BBC soap told DS: "EastEnders has made the decision to substantially rewrite the current storyline featuring Dawn Swann and Dr May Wright due to the events surrounding the disappearance of Madeleine McCann.

"In the current circumstances it was felt any storyline that included a child abduction would be inappropriate and could cause distress to our viewers."
